About the Webinar
Nearly a decade after the last major outbreak, the threat of Bundibugyo virus disease (BDBV), a rare but severe viral hemorrhagic fever, remains persistent at the nexus of Uganda and the Democratic Republic of the Congo.
Join the World Society for Virology for a rare open-access session with one of the world's foremost authorities on high-consequence pathogens.
Prof. Janusz T. Paweska
A titan in Global Health Security, Prof. Paweska brings decades of frontline experience:
•    In response to the Ebola outbreak in West Africa, he successfully established and led the operation of the South African Ebola mobile laboratory in Sierra Leone in 2014–2015
•    Former Head: Centre for Emerging Zoonotic & Parasitic Diseases (NICD-NHLS)
•    Former Head: WHO Regional Collaborating Centre for Viral Haemorrhagic Fevers
•    Former Deputy Director: SACIDS (Southern Centre for Infectious Diseases Surveillance)
•    Regional Director: Global Viral Network
•    Lead: South African Global Health Security Agenda (Zoonotic Diseases)
